Safety Tips For Watching Younger Children — In Summer

Safety Tips For Watching Younger Children — In Summer

When the weather heats up, it’s even more important to make sure kids are hydrated when playing outside. Make sure your child drinks water at least 30 minutes before going outside and every 15 to 20 minutes during playtime. Our Safe Sitter classes provide kids ages 11 to 14 with helpful safety tips for watching younger children, including heat-related emergencies, first aid, and more. Our next class will be held on Friday, June 13 from 8:30am to 3:00pm at Fire and Emergency Services Headquarters, located at 408 Hurricane Shoals Road NE in Lawrenceville. Happy 205th Birthday To Florence Nightingale

Happy 205th Birthday To Florence Nightingale

We would like to wish a Happy 205th Birthday to Florence Nightingale — the founder of modern nursing! “The Lady with the Lamp” is well remembered for prioritizing sanitation and individual care when treating British soldiers during the Crimean War in 1854. To combat mass infections and low hygiene, Nightingale and her 38 nurses began cleaning every room and stressed handwashing in unsanitary conditions. This helped bring the death rate at her military hospital down from 40 to 2 percent. Always remember to practice both proper sanitation and handwashing!
